Инструменты управления¶
В ADS предусмотрено 2 вида операций:
- Операции на уровне кластера – предполагают выполнение операций последовательно над всеми сервисами;
- Операции на уровне сервиса – предполагают выполнение операций над отдельным сервисом.
Операции на уровне кластера¶
Запуск и остановка ADS – существует возможность последовательного запуска и остановки всех сервисов кластера ADS через ADCM. Для этого необходимо открыть в ADCM кластер ADS и нажать кнопку Start, Stop или Restart в зависимости от требуемой работы с кластером (Рис.32).

Рис. 32. Операции на уровне кластера
В результате того или иного действия кластер меняет свое состояние на соответствующее – running или stopped, в том случае если кластер уже проинсталлирован и не находится в состоянии created.
Операции на уровне сервиса¶
Для каждого из сервисов доступна возможность проверки его работоспособности, а также управления им независимо от остальных. Например, проверка работоспособности сервиса Kafka представляет собой создание тестовых топиков и проверку их доступности на каждом из хостов BROKER. А проверка работоспособности сервиса Zookeeper представляет собой подключение к кворуму Zookeeper, создание в нем тестовой znode и проверку доступности созданной znode каждому из хостов кворума.
Проверка состояний сервисов и вывод результатов действий над ними осуществляется по единому алгоритму, разобранному на примере сервиса Zookeeper:
- В ADCM перейти в кластер ADS. На вкладке “Services” для сервиса Zookeeper в поле “Actions” нажать на пиктограмму и выбрать действие Check (Рис.33).

Рис. 33. Запуск проверки состояния сервиса Zookeeper
- Открыть вкладку “JOBS” (Рис.34).

Рис. 34. Вкладка “JOBS”
- Выбрать последнее действие над кластером ADS и в открывшемся окне проверить результаты (Рис.35).

Рис. 35. Проверка состояния сервиса Zookeeper
Запуск и остановка сервисов¶
Для каждого из сервисов есть возможность управления им независимо от остальных, выполняя такие операции как Stop, Start, Restart.
Например, чтобы перезапустить все компоненты сервиса Kafka, необходимо в ADCM перейти в кластер ADS, на вкладке “Services” для сервиса Kafka в поле “Actions” нажать на пиктограмму и выбрать действие Restart.
В результате того или иного действия статус сервиса меняется на running или stopped, в том случае если сервис уже установлен и не находится в состоянии created.